The Beautiful World of Clear Balloons
Training by Pink Tree Balloon Training | Tutor: Paula Ardron-Gemmell
The world of clear balloons is ever-expanding, and knowing which balloon to use – and when – can be confusing, even for experienced balloon artists.

This course has been designed to challenge those myths and give you a clear, practical understanding of how different clear bubble-style balloons should be used in professional décor.
All you need to know about clear bubble-type balloons – but were afraid to ask.
This is a multi-manufacturer course, covering:
-
Takara Kosan Aqua Balloons
-
Grabo Transparent Globes
-
Takarakosan Deco Bubble / T-Balloon
-
Anagram Clearz
-
Bobos
Clear balloons play a major role in modern, professional balloon décor. This training shows you:
-
How to use each type correctly
-
Which balloons are best suited to different décor styles
-
When to use each balloon to achieve maximum impact
The course explores the similarities and differences between all clear balloon types and includes hands-on experience to help you use them effectively and with confidence.

By the end of the course, you’ll feel confident working with all major clear balloons on the market – from Aqua Balloons to Grabo Globes – and gain a clear understanding of what Bobo balloons are, and why they are not considered the professional’s preferred choice.
This is an intermediate-level course, suitable for balloon artists who already have experience with basic inflation and balloon techniques and want to get the very most from clear balloons.
